Henry 887 Tropi-Cool 100% Silicone Tan Roof Coating is a premium, 100% silicone, moisture-cure coating designed to reflect the sun's heat and UV rays as well as protect many types of roofs. While suitable for use in all climates, the 100% silicone chemistry is especially suited for extreme tropical environments, which are exposed to some of the hottest and wettest weather with intense UV exposure. It is specially designed to maintain maximum reflectivity of heat and UV rays as it ages. Its moisture-cure chemistry creates a very aggressive chemical bond with the roof, which allows for permanent ponding water resistance, extreme durability, and superior capabilities of sealing and protection.

Hi Greg, in order to spray Henry 887 TropiCool 100% Silicone you will need a commercial airless spray rig capable of producing a minimum of 3500 psi at the spray gun tip. The pump should have a 3 gallons per minute output and be fed by a 5:1 transfer pump to prevent cavitation. Hoses should be Buna-N jacketed for prevention of moisture contamination. The spray gun should be high pressure (5000 psi) with a reverse-a-clean spray tip, having a minimum orifice of 0.30 and a 50 degree fan tip. Do not use hoses that have been used for acrylics because the liners absorb moisture and initiate the silicone curing process. Thank you for trusting in Henry and Home Depot.

Mike, clean-up of tools and spray equipment containing uncured material may be accomplished by cleaning or flushing with VM&P Naphtha or mineral spirits. VM&P Naphtha has a higher solvency than mineral spirits.
FrankO, in almost all case no primer is needed for an application to a metal roof. However, prior to the application of Henry 887, best practices suggest that you should do an adhesion test to see how well the product sticks to the roof. The application of Henry 887 only requires a single coat, but you can add multiple coats if you want to. Complete multiple coats within 48 hours of each other. Otherwise, you will need to clean the roof again.
